Python 3.x 为什么python包http.server只能在本地工作?

Python 3.x 为什么python包http.server只能在本地工作?,python-3.x,windows,http,server,fileserver,Python 3.x,Windows,Http,Server,Fileserver,使用命令时 python -m Http.server 8000 --bind 192.168.1.105 服务器仅在与设备地址绑定后才为本地主机提供服务 我已尝试使用0.0.0.0绑定 python -m Http.server 8000 --bind 0.0.0.0 但一切都没有改变 并且设备上没有运行VPN 我在windows平台上工作,试图通过手机和Linux平台访问服务器 我一直从客户端的设备浏览器收到一条消息,说地址无法访问您的设备是否都连接到同一个网络?@MobrineHayd

使用命令时

python -m Http.server 8000 --bind 192.168.1.105
服务器仅在与设备地址绑定后才为本地主机提供服务 我已尝试使用0.0.0.0绑定

python -m Http.server 8000 --bind 0.0.0.0
但一切都没有改变 并且设备上没有运行VPN 我在windows平台上工作,试图通过手机和Linux平台访问服务器
我一直从客户端的设备浏览器收到一条消息,说地址无法访问

您的设备是否都连接到同一个网络?@MobrineHayde是的!你可以检查一下,这很有帮助